PHILADELPHIA, Dec. 8, 2010 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- Lincoln Financial Network, the retail distribution division of Lincoln Financial Group (NYSE: LNC), announced today that Tim Gilleylen has been named Managing Director of the Mid-America Region and will be based out of Detroit, Mich.

Gilleylen, who joined the company in November, is responsible for recruiting, coaching and developing Lincoln Financial Network-affiliated financial planners in and around the Detroit and Cincinnati areas. He is a 19-year industry veteran.
"Tim is savvy , strategic and creative – three traits which will serve him well as he helps Lincoln grow and develop its base of high quality financial planners," said David Berkowitz, Senior Vice President of Lincoln Financial Advisors.
Prior to joining Lincoln Financial Advisors, Gilleylen spent more than 19 years with Morgan Stanley Smith Barney, in a variety of leadership positions, and recently serving as Complex Business Development Officer. He earned a Bachelor of Arts degree in economics/political science from Michigan State University and holds his Series 7, 8, 63, 65 and 3.
About Lincoln Financial Network
Lincoln Financial Network is the marketing name for the retail sales and financial planning affiliates of Lincoln Financial Group and includes Lincoln Financial Advisors Corp. and Lincoln Financial Securities Corporation, both members of FINRA and SIPC. Consisting of approximately 7,800 representatives, career agents, and full-service financial planners throughout the United States, Lincoln Financial Network professionals can offer financial planning and advisory services, retirement services, life products, annuities, investments, and trust services to affluent individuals, business owners, and families.
About Lincoln Financial Group
Lincoln Financial Group is the marketing name for Lincoln National Corporation (NYSE: LNC) and its affiliates. With headquarters in the Philadelphia region, the companies of Lincoln Financial Group had assets under management of $150 billion as of September 30, 2010. Through its affiliated companies, Lincoln Financial Group offers: annuities; life, group life and disability insurance; 401(k) and 403(b) plans; savings plans; and comprehensive financial planning and advisory services.
